Care and Longevity Tips
With regular cleaning, mild conditioning of leather parts, and mindful storage away from harsh sunlight, Amelia Earhart shoes can maintain their vintage-inspired looks for years. Treating seams and soles with appropriate protectors extends weather resistance and preserves the handcrafted details that collectors value.
- Wipe off dirt after each wear with a soft brush or damp cloth.
- Use a mild leather conditioner every few months to prevent cracking.
- Air out shoes overnight to reduce odor and material fatigue.
- Store them in a cool, dry place with cedar shoe trees for structured models.
- Rotate pairs to avoid compressing midsoles and cushioning layers.
